This model is a spring-assisted folding knife, not a fully automatic OTF. That distinction matters for legality. In many regions, assisted openers are treated differently—and often more leniently—than true automatic OTF knives.
However, knife laws vary widely by state, city, and country. Blade length, assisted mechanisms, and how you carry the knife can all affect legality. Before you buy or carry, always check your local laws and regulations to confirm that a spring-assisted pocket knife with a 3.5-inch blade is permitted in your area.

| Blade Length (inches) | 3.5 |
| Overall Length (inches) | 8 |
| Closed Length (inches) | 4.5 |
| Blade Color | Black |
| Blade Finish | Matte |
| Blade Style | Drop Point |
| Blade Edge | Partial-Serrated |
| Blade Material | Steel |
| Handle Finish | Matte |
| Handle Material | Nylon Fiber |
| Theme | None |
| Pocket Clip | Yes |
| Deployment Method | Spring-assisted |
| Lock Type | Liner lock |
